Linux高级知识

十一、LAMP架构

1、LAMP架构介绍、MySQL、MariaDB介绍、MySQL安装

2、MariaDB和Apache安装

3、安装PHP5和PHP7

4、Apache和PHP结合、Apache默认虚拟主机

5、Apache用户认证、域名跳转、Apache访问日志

6、访问日志不记录静态文件、访问日志切割、静态元素过期时间

7、配置防盗链、访问控制Directory和FilesMatch

8、限定某个目录禁止解析php、限制user_agent、php相关配置

9、PHP扩展模块安装

十二、LNMP架构

1、LNMP架构介绍、MySQL和PHP安装、Nginx介绍

2、Nginx安装、默认虚拟主机、Nginx用户认证和域名重定向

3、Nginx访问日志、日志切割、静态文件不记录日志和过期时间

4、Nginx防盗链、访问控制、解析PHP相关配置及Nginx代理

5、Nginx负载均衡、SSL原理、生成SSL密钥对、Nginx配置SSL

6、php-fpm的pool、php-fpm慢执行日志、open_basedir、php-fpm进程管理

十三、MySQL常用操作

1、设置更改root密码、连接mysql、mysql常用命令

2、mysql用户管理、常用sql语句、mysql数据库备份恢复

十四、NFS服务搭建与配置

1、NFS介绍、服务端安装配置、NFS配置选项

2、exportfs命令、NFS客户端问题、FTP介绍、使用vsftpd搭建ftp

十五、FTP服务搭建与配置

1、xshell使用xftp传输文件、使用pure-ftpd搭建ftp服务

十六、Tomcat配置

1、Tomcat介绍、安装JDK、安装Tomcat

2、配置Tomcat监听80端口、配置Tomcat虚拟主机、Tomcat日志

十七、MySQL主从配置

1、MySQL主从介绍、配置主从、测试主从同步

2、MySQL主从扩展知识

十八、Linux集群架构

1、Linux集群介绍、keepalived介绍及配置高可用集群

2、负载均衡集群介绍、LVS介绍、LVS调度算法、LVS NAT模式搭建

3、LVS DR模式搭建、keepalived + LVS

十九、Linux监控平台搭建

1、Linux监控平台介绍、zabbix监控介绍、安装zabbix、忘记Admin密码如何做

2、主动模式和被动模式、添加监控主机、添加自定义模板、处理图形中的乱码、自动发现

3、添加自定义监控项目、配置邮件告警、测试告警、不发邮件的问题处理

二十、shell编程

1、shell脚本介绍、shell脚本结构和执行、date命令用法、shell脚本中的变量

2、shell脚本中的逻辑判断、文件目录属性判断、if特殊用法、case判断

3、for循环、while循环、break跳出循环、continue结束本次循环、exit退出整个脚本

4、shell中的函数、shell中的数组、告警系统需求分析

5、告警系统主脚本和配置文件以及监控项目

6、告警系统邮件引擎、运行告警系统

7、分发系统介绍、expect脚本远程登录、expect脚本远程执行命令、expect脚本传递参数

8、expect脚本同步文件、expect脚本指定host和要同步的文件、构建文件分发系统、批量远程执行命令

Linux高级知识的更多相关文章

  1. Linux基础知识第六讲,远程管理ssh操作

    目录 Linux基础知识第六讲,远程管理ssh操作 一丶什么是SSH 1.什么是SSH 2.了解域名跟端口 二丶SSH命令以及远程连接linux进行维护 1.ssh命令格式 2.scp远程终端拷贝文件 ...

  2. MySQL高级知识(十五)——主从复制

    前言:本章主要讲解MySQL主从复制的操作步骤.由于环境限制,主机使用Windows环境,从机使用用Linux环境.另外MySQL的版本最好一致,笔者采用的MySQL5.7.22版本,具体安装过程请查 ...

  3. MySQL高级知识(一)——基础

    前言:MySQL高级知识主要来自尚硅谷中MySQL的视频资源.对于网上视频资源来说,尚硅谷是一个非常好的选择.通过对相应部分的学习,笔者可以说收益颇丰,非常感谢尚硅谷. 1.关于MySQL的一些文件 ...

  4. 《Mysql高级知识》系列分享专栏

    <Mysql高级知识>已整理成PDF文档,点击可直接下载至本地查阅https://www.webfalse.com/read/201756.html 文章 MySQL数据库InnoDB引擎 ...

  5. 大数据学习笔记——Linux基本知识及指令(理论部分)

    Linux学习笔记整理 上一篇博客中,我们详细地整理了如何从0部署一套Linux操作系统,那么这一篇就承接上篇文章,我们仔细地把Linux的一些基础知识以及常用指令(包括一小部分高级命令)做一个梳理, ...

  6. Linux基础知识入门

    [Linux基础]Linux基础知识入门及常见命令.   前言:最近刚安装了Linux系统, 所以学了一些最基本的操作, 在这里把自己总结的笔记记录在这里. 1,V8:192.168.40.10V1: ...

  7. 运维之linux基础知识(一)

    运维之linux基础知识(一) 1.GUI:Graphic User Interface 图形用户界面 2.CLI:Command line Interface 命令行界面 3 dll:Dynamic ...

  8. 运维之Linux基础知识(三)

    运维之Linux基础知识(三) 1. 查看文本 cat tac more less head tail 1.1 cat 连接并显示文件 cat -n:在显示的时候,将每一行编号 -E:显示结束符$ - ...

  9. 自理一遍android 高级知识

    之后按目录得复习巩固 目录: 客卓高级知识整理 1 移动架构 1.1 素养与基础 1.1.1 主流设计模式 创建型 行为型 结构型 1.1.2 UML 1.1.3 设计原则 1.1.4 AOP架构 1 ...

随机推荐

  1. pythonpip的基本使用

    pip 是 Python 包管理工具,该工具提供了对Python 包的查找.下载.安装.卸载的功能.目前如果你在 python.org 下载最新版本的安装包,则是已经自带了该工具.Python 2.7 ...

  2. 在虚拟机上的关于FTP FTP访问模式(本地用户模式)

    首先你要有vsftpd服务 可以先去yum中下载(当然你要有本地yum仓库) 输入命令: yum  install  vsftpd 下载完成之后打开vsftpd服务 输入命令:systemctl   ...

  3. Redis过期--淘汰机制的解析和内存占用过高的解决方案

    echo编辑整理,欢迎转载,转载请声明文章来源.欢迎添加echo微信(微信号:t2421499075)交流学习. 百战不败,依不自称常胜,百败不颓,依能奋力前行.--这才是真正的堪称强大!!! Red ...

  4. Java基础系列5:深入理解Java异常体系

    该系列博文会告诉你如何从入门到进阶,一步步地学习Java基础知识,并上手进行实战,接着了解每个Java知识点背后的实现原理,更完整地了解整个Java技术体系,形成自己的知识框架. 前言: Java的基 ...

  5. linux 相关指令

    modinfo   *.ko     显示驱动文件的信息.

  6. html5 微信真机调试方法vConsole

    html5 微信真机调试方法 vConsolehttps://blog.csdn.net/weixin_36934930/article/details/79870240

  7. 深入理解java继承从“我爸是李刚”讲起

    目录 1.继承的概述 2.关于继承之后的成员变量 3.关于继承之后的成员方法 4.关于继承之后的构造方法 5.关于继承的多态性支持的例子 6.super与this的用法 前言 本文主要多方面讲解jav ...

  8. Java虚拟机-字节码指令

    目录 字节码指令 字节码与数据类型 加载和存储指令 运算指令 类型转换指令 对象创建与访问指令 操作数栈管理指令 控制转移指令 方法调用和返回指令 异常处理指令 同步指令 字节码指令 Java虚拟机的 ...

  9. 解决vue低版本安卓手机兼容性问题

    低版本的安卓手机可能会白屏,是由新特性不支持引起的 解决代码es6新特性兼容问题 1,npm 安装 npm install babel-polyfill npm install es6-promise ...

  10. [ISE调试] 在ISE调试过程中,遇到过的error以及消除办法

    1.Incompatible IOB's are locked to the same bank 15,具体如右图, 于是去查引脚配置,发现 也就是说,在bank=15的这组IO里面,我既选了LVAM ...